SHERIDAN, Wyo., Sept. 7, 2026 /CourierPR/ -- Wissen Research, a global market intelligence and consulting firm, has released a new study forecasting significant growth in the stem cells market over the next five years. According to the report, the global stem cells market is expected to expand from approximately $18.9 billion in 2026 to $32.57 billion by 2031, at a compound annual growth rate (CAGR) of 11.5%.

The growth is driven by several factors. Firstly, the rising interest in regenerative medicine and the increasing use of cell-based therapies are key contributors. Additionally, an aging population and the prevalence of chronic and degenerative diseases are pushing healthcare systems and biotech companies to explore stem cell-based treatment options. These therapies are seen as alternatives or complements to conventional treatments, particularly for conditions such as cancer, neurological disorders, cardiovascular disease, and orthopedic issues.

Improvements in the sourcing, processing, and storage of stem cells are also facilitating the transition from lab research to clinical use. Induced pluripotent stem cells (iPSCs), which can be generated from adult tissue, are receiving particular attention due to their potential to sidestep ethical questions associated with embryonic stem cells. Allogeneic therapies, which are derived from donor cells and can be produced in bulk, are gaining traction for their scalability and off-the-shelf manufacturing potential.

The report highlights that the pharmaceutical and biotechnology sectors are at the forefront of stem cell research and development, with increasing investment in clinical trials and cell therapy pipelines. Better cell acquisition, culture, and cryopreservation techniques are improving the consistency and commercial scalability of these therapies. Beyond therapy, stem cells are also being used in drug discovery, toxicity testing, and disease modeling, providing pharmaceutical companies with faster and more relevant tools for evaluating new compounds.

North America remains the largest market for stem cells, supported by a concentration of major pharmaceutical and biotechnology companies, well-established research institutions, and mature clinical trial infrastructure. However, the Asia-Pacific region is expanding at the fastest pace, driven by rising healthcare investment and expanding biotech infrastructure in countries such as China, Japan, South Korea, and India.

Several strategic developments have recently taken place in the stem cells market. In March 2026, Applied StemCell and Cellipont Bioservices announced a collaboration aimed at accelerating the development of iPSC-derived cell therapies by pairing engineering and banking capabilities with manufacturing and regulatory support. In January 2026, Aspect Biosystems and Novo Nordisk deepened their existing partnership, with Aspect gaining access to Novo Nordisk's islet cell and hypoimmune cell engineering technology, as well as additional funding support. Also in January 2026, South Korea's MEDIPOST raised approximately $140 million to advance its donor-derived mesenchymal stem cell therapy through late-stage clinical trials and expand manufacturing capacity.

The study notes that adult stem cells, particularly hematopoietic and mesenchymal types, continue to dominate the market due to their well-established clinical use in transplantation and tissue regeneration. These cells have a safety profile that makes them the default starting point for many new therapeutic programs. On the therapy side, the shift toward allogeneic, donor-derived approaches reflects an industry-wide push towards standardized, scalable production, which could significantly lower costs and expand patient access over time.

Wissen Research's analysis indicates that the global stem cells market is segmented by product, application, technology, therapy, end-user, and region. The report provides detailed forecasts, competitive insights, and growth opportunities for companies operating in this space. For instance, adult stem cells led the market by product type in 2025, capturing about 72% of global revenue, reflecting their established track record in transplantation and tissue repair applications.

The research underscores that sustained investment in manufacturing scalability, regulatory navigation, and strategic partnerships will be crucial for companies aiming to capture a larger share of this growth. As cell processing technologies mature and regenerative medicine moves into mainstream clinical practice, stem cells are expected to become a central pillar of the broader biotechnology and pharmaceutical landscape.
